Green Hollow
Green Hollow is a valley in Centre County, Pennsylvania and has an elevation of 843 feet. Green Hollow is situated nearby to the hamlet Monument, as well as near Orviston.Places in the Area

Orviston is an unincorporated community and census-designated place in Curtin Township, Centre County, Pennsylvania, United States. As of the 2010 census, the population was 95. Orviston is situated 2 miles west of Green Hollow.
